Wawrinka wins Prague Challenger

Final day in the Prague Challenger.

2020 I.CLTK Prague Open By Moneta an ATP Challenger tournament, on Red Clay, in Prague, Czech Republic, 15-22 August 2020.

Defending champion:

Qualifier Mario Vilella Martinez who defeated Tseng Chun-hsin 6-4 6-2


The final:


Wildcard Stan Wawrinka (1) (Switzerland) v Aslan Karatsev (Russia)


Wawrinka served first, and the first two games would be the longest of the opening set.

The top seed lost two points at 40-30, but saved the break point to hold.

Karatsev, from 15-40 in the next game, saved the two break points, plus another to equalise at 1-1.

No hassle from the line for either player after that, at least for ten games, Wawrinka winning 21 of 26 points, and Karatsev 21 of 28 points, on their respective serves.

The Russian won the first two points of the tie break, but none thereafter, leaving Switzerland ahead 7-6(2).


Set two saw Wawrinka convert the second of two chances to break in game three. He couldn’t take advantage of another opportunity in game five, but still led 4-2 before Karatsev endured three trips to deuce to keep it close.

Karatsev held again for 4-5, but Wawrinka had no difficulty serving it out to take the title, 7-6(2) 6-4 the final scoreline.


Wawrinka moves up two spots in the rankings to #15, and Karatsev jumps 58 places into the top 200 at #195.
